I would lawyer up.

A guy I work with got a Trailblazer SS that's a heap. He's had the differentials, transfer case, headliner, and bumper cover replaced (some more than once). The bumper cover came off when he was doing 130 in it lol. It's had a bunch of electrical problems and wheel clear coat flake off too. He got a lawyer and after a couple months GM settled. They paid off his loan, gave him $10k cash (half of which went to the lawyer) AND they let him keep the truck but canceled the remainder of his warranty.
